
It’s been a long time since our last ash drive for our ASHMuskoka Program – 6 months, in fact. We are sincerely grateful for your patience during this time and for continuing to save your ash in order to help restore vital calcium levels in our Muskoka forests and lakes.
We are announcing today that ash drives will be resuming beginning August 15th with a total of 7 currently scheduled for the remainder of 2020. They will take place at the Rosewarne Transfer Station in Bracebridge from 9am to 3pm on the following Saturdays:
- August 15th
- August 29th
- September 12th
- September 26th
- October 24th
- November 21st
- December 19th
We are holding 2 ash drives in each of August and September as many of you have informed us that you have large quantities of ash saved. We want to make it as convenient as we can at this point for you to drop off the ash to us.
